•
Use the dishwasher only for
its intended function.
•
Use only detergents or rinse
agents recommended for
use in a dishwasher, and keep
them out of the reach of
children.

•
Do not wash plastic items
unless they are marked
“dishwasher safe” or the
equivalent. For plastic
items not so marked,
check the manufacturer’s
recommendations.
•
If the dishwasher drains
into a food disposer, ensure
disposer is completely
empty before running the
dishwasher.
•
Do not tamper with or
override controls and
interlocks.
•
Do not touch the heating
element during or
immediately after use.
•
Do not operate the
dishwasher unless all
enclosure panels are properly
in place.
•
Do not tamper with controls.
•
Do not abuse, sit on, or stand
on the door, lid, or dish racks
of the dishwasher.
